Output f686cacbbef8f8ed45760be875393fe595f052d09de987f4bb1d36f89f39aa09:1

value
15446565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f48c58d727677b7455de7be70c0528f947a6c123 OP_EQUAL
address
3Pz4vqH5hWzBxbf5v6CWCckmXqEdW1Mr1o
transaction
f686cacbbef8f8ed45760be875393fe595f052d09de987f4bb1d36f89f39aa09
confirmations
326864
spent
true